Output 63818b18488f763f1021a19737b65154a3604dcb190141fb9587663769117648:1

value
86995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99124e86f7faee11ebc96414e7c2f038d7d1dbcd OP_EQUALVERIFY OP_CHECKSIG
address
1ExNKKrkB8qF4ZtmWrDBwaDj4HKPZbtbdA
transaction
63818b18488f763f1021a19737b65154a3604dcb190141fb9587663769117648
confirmations
109324
spent
true